Output e0c2da891804f7a643c69cba24386c7632e015fd9f1b58ea898bd7f438c6d187:1

value
42080
script pubkey
OP_HASH160 OP_PUSHBYTES_20 002efda09308571e044ad257fc5d5ad88b99aa38 OP_EQUAL
address
31hzDWwUqxN8NK9jPQCqutYqRFuHLUyVfG
transaction
e0c2da891804f7a643c69cba24386c7632e015fd9f1b58ea898bd7f438c6d187
spent
true